A NEW TYPE OF BRITISH RAILWAY LOCOMOTIVE. The giant locomotive recently constructed for the London and North Eastern Railway Company to the design of Mr. H. N. Grosley, the company’s chief mechanical engineer. The principles embodied in the boiler construction are entirely new to British railway practice. The engine is specially designed for high speed traffic.
